The Church Today
St John the Baptist Catholic School moved away from its original site next to the church in 1989, when a new building was provided on Whitehawk Hill. The convent chapel is now used as a rest home, although its origins as a chapel are still apparent. The church holds Masses on Saturday evenings, Sunday mornings and Holy Days of Obligation.
The church has been listed at Grade II* since 13 October 1952. As of February 2001, it was one of 70 Grade II*-listed buildings and structures, and 1,218 listed buildings of all grades, in the city of Brighton and Hove.
